Colorado four-piece Skeleton of God are another band that I sought out back in my tape trading days in my quest for ever more extreme forms of metal with their debut E.P. "Urine Garden" receiving quite a few plays back in the day. The Skeleton of God sound could be described as a quite technical, avant-garde & progressive take on the brutal death metal model although these guys were clearly still finding their sound so some tracks are definitely more unusual than others. You can't deny the ambition from such a young group of dudes but I do have to admit that I prefer the conventional material like highlight track "10 Second Infinity" over the more intentionally weird inclusions (see the opening title track for example). The way Skeleton of God construct their riffs is quite unique though & this attribute gives the band their edge, along with the gutteral vocals of guitarist Jeff Kahn which are very effective. It's a real shame that the production job isn't adequate for this type of release though as I feel it may have picked up more of an underground reputation with a cleaner & more powerful sound.

For fans of Human Remains, Wicked Innocence & Embrionic Death.
